#87ce98 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#87ce98 is composed of 52.9% red, 80.8%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 26.2%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 134.4 degrees, a saturation of 42% and a lightness of 66.9%. #87ce98 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#0f9d31.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

● #87ce98 color description : Slightly desaturated lime green.
#87ce98 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#87ce98 has RGB values of R:135, G:206, B:152 and CMYK values of C:0.34, M:0, Y:0.26,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 8900248.
